Technical Backing and Cost Savings in Coastal Construction

Analysis of the financial landscape, supply logistics, and regional budget challenges

Investing in construction in coastal cities like Bombinhas requires strategic intelligence that goes beyond technical execution. The cost per square meter in the region, driven by high real estate valuation and seasonality, imposes severe logistical challenges. Fluctuations in freight and material prices, often exacerbated by the peninsular geography of Bombinhas, can increase the initial budget by 10% to 15% if planning is not precise.

The ABNT NBR 12721 serves as a benchmark, but field reality requires refinement based on the regional SINAPI adapted to the specificities of coastal costs. Waste does not occur only on the construction site, but in the initial pricing that ignores latent risks, such as salt spray, restricted logistics for the entry and exit of heavy trucks, and, fundamentally, legal protection against third-party damages.

When we discuss the neighborhood inspection report, we are not talking about a mere documentary formality, but a tool for capital preservation. The financial impact of a lawsuit for structural damage to neighboring buildings can paralyze the physical-financial schedule for months, creating a domino effect of extra costs due to team idleness, equipment rental extensions, and bank interest on construction financing.

Mapping bottlenecks, frequent costing errors, and capital leakage points on site

Many developers fail by treating the neighborhood inspection report as an isolated cost, when, in fact, it is a technical insurance policy. On the construction site, the most common costing errors that lead to resource drainage include:

  • Idleness due to Judicial Stoppage: A construction site embargoed by complaints from neighboring residents costs, on average, three times its planned monthly value.
  • Underestimation of Soil Risks: Coastal geotechnics are complex. Foundation works without a proper prior report are easy targets for claims, even if the damage is pre-existing.
  • Logistics of Supplies: The lack of a delivery schedule aligned with local road traffic generates double storage costs and loss of materials due to exposure to extreme humidity.
  • Labor Management: In Bombinhas, seasonality affects the cost of skilled labor. Without a preventive and efficient schedule, staff turnover directly impacts the productivity curve.

The capital that flows into paying indemnities, urgent judicial expert examinations, and unplanned reconstructions is, invariably, capital subtracted from the finishing quality of the project, decreasing its final market value.

Sensitivity Table for Costs and Regional Logistics

Material Category (ABC Curve) Local Logistical Impact Price Fluctuation Risk WGB Storage/Purchase Strategy
Steel and Metal Structure High (Difficult access logistics) High (Indexed to Dollar/Market) Scheduled purchase with locked-in lots
Ready-mix Concrete Critical (Just-in-time mandatory) Moderate (Regional plant sourcing) Exclusive supply contracts
High-End Finishes Medium (Sensitive to salt spray) Low (Prices fixed by contract) Protected storage in dry environment
Outsourced Services (Inspection/Report) Low (High technical availability) None (Fixed engineering costs) Preventive contracting before foundation

Frequently Asked Questions about Budgeting and Costing

Why is the cost of a preventive inspection considered savings rather than an expense?
Savings are generated by the opportunity cost. The amount spent on the report is a tiny fraction (often less than 0.5% of the total CUB) compared to the cost of a 30-day work stoppage, which can easily exceed 5% of the total value of the project due to fines, interest, and site maintenance.

How does the neighborhood inspection report directly influence financial planning in Bombinhas?
Bombinhas has geographical particularities that make neighborhood control essential. The construction density near the coast increases the risk of impacts on neighboring structures. With the report, the budget is kept ‘shielded’ from surprises, allowing the investor to focus on their return on investment (ROI) without the worry of judicial unforeseen events.

What standards does WGB use to ensure the legal validity of these documents?
Our reports are issued strictly following the guidelines of the IBAPE (Brazilian Institute of Engineering Assessments and Expert Examinations), ensuring public faith and legal robustness to act in any instance, while maintaining compliance with the ABNT standards that govern our profession.
